xdlumia/vue3-video-play

引入项目后报错,pakage.json配置的module是不对应的

Opened this issue · 8 comments

Failed to resolve entry for package "vue3-video-play". The package may have incorrect main/module/exports specified in its package.json.

无法解析包“vue3-video-play”的条目。该包的 package.json 中指定的 main/module/exports 可能不正确。

您好 解决了吗 我也报这个错误了

import { videoPlay } from 'vue3-video-play/lib/index' import 'vue3-video-play/dist/style.css' // 引入css

直接导入可以使用

import { videoPlay } from 'vue3-video-play/lib/index' import 'vue3-video-play/dist/style.css' // 引入css

直接导入可以使用

使用vite,npm run dev没问题,build就不行,怎么解决?

+1 最后怎么解决的呀?run dev 没问题,build 报错!

下载我的包吧,这个项目作者应该不维护了,npm i longze-vue3-video-player --save, main.js或 main.ts导入(全局导入):
import { createApp } from "vue";
import App from "./App.vue";
let app = createApp(App);

import longzeVideoPlay from "longze-vue3-video-player"; // 引入组件
import "longze-vue3-video-player/dist/style.css"; // 引入css
app.use(longzeVideoPlay);

app.mount("#app");

引入的时候改成这样就可以了,打包也不会报错:import { videoPlay } from "vue3-video-play/dist/index.mjs";